When's the best time to book a family-friendly holiday in Lake Louise?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 9°C, while the coldest months are December and February, with an average of -12°C. The snowiest months in Lake Louise are January, February, April and November, with each month seeing an average of 315 cm of snowfall.
What's there to see and do with your family in Lake Louise?
While you are holidaying in Lake Louise, you and the family may want to see some interesting spots such as Lake Louise Mountain Resort and Lake Louise. Make sure that you have plenty of time to take in activities in the area such as Banff National Park, Moraine Lake and Yoho National Park.
What's the best way for us to get around Lake Louise?
To venture out into the surrounding area, take a train from Lake Louise Station. Lake Louise might not have many public transport options to choose from, so consider renting a car to explore more.
